Open-source MCP servers for Ditto Assistant — Google Workspace, Home Assistant, and more
Ditto MCP Servers
Open-source MCP (Model Context Protocol) servers for Ditto Assistant. Each server runs as a local home server — a Next.js app on your machine with a setup GUI, ngrok tunnel for connectivity, and bearer-token auth so only Ditto can call it.

The MCP endpoint (/api/mcp) is protected by a bearer token that is auto-generated on first run and displayed in the dashboard. Ditto connects through the ngrok tunnel using that token.

Setup Wizard
Step 1 — Google OAuth Credentials
You need a Google Cloud OAuth client to let the server call Gmail, Calendar, Docs, Sheets, and Drive on your behalf.
- Go to Google Cloud Console → create or select a project
- Enable these APIs (APIs & Services → Library):
- Gmail API
- Google Calendar API
- Google Docs API
- Google Sheets API
- Google Drive API
- Go to APIs & Services → OAuth consent screen
- User type: External
- Add your Google email as a test user
- Go to APIs & Services → Credentials → Create Credentials → OAuth 2.0 Client ID
- Application type: Web application
- Authorized redirect URI:
http://localhost:3100/api/google/callback
- Copy the Client ID and Client Secret into the wizard
Step 2 — Sign in with Google
Click Sign in with Google to authorize the server to access your Google Workspace.
Step 3 — ngrok Token
Paste your ngrok auth token. This creates a public HTTPS tunnel so Ditto's backend can reach your local server.
Optionally enter a reserved domain (e.g. my-ditto.ngrok-free.app) for a stable URL that survives restarts. You can reserve one for free at dashboard.ngrok.com/domains.
Step 4 — Choose Services
Toggle on/off Gmail, Calendar, Docs, Sheets, and Drive.
Step 5 — Launch
Click Start Server to open the ngrok tunnel. You'll see the live tunnel URL.

Keeping It Running
The server must be running on your machine for Ditto to use your Google Workspace tools.
Restart after reboot: Run pnpm dev again from the project directory. The ngrok tunnel will reconnect automatically (click "Restart Tunnel" in the dashboard if needed). All credentials are saved in ~/.ditto-mcp-servers/google-workspace/ so you won't need to redo setup.
Reserved domain (optional): If you reserved a free ngrok domain, the tunnel URL stays the same across restarts — you only need to register the MCP server in Ditto once.
